right guys here we go but first i should explain a little about what i'm planning for this kit.

i started a thread about this kit just before christmas as i thought the instruction sheet in the box was wrong about the colour scheme for the A/C.
after a discussion between several members it was generaly accepted that there should an RLM74/75/76 cammo pattern but without the yellow cowl ring, which should be RLM76 instead, and also no yellow wing tips as stated on the box !

so based on the above

i've painted the undercart doors RLM76 on the oustside also painted the lower surface of the horisontal stabs the same colour

the cowl ring is done, also in RLM76 and was assembled with the painted prop and cooling fan and black spinner with white spiral

wheelbays painted in dark grey
